ALEXANDRIA FRADY
Alexandria Frady’s work has been shaped by the places she has lived, each leaving a lasting impression and helping her grow as an artist. Born in Tokyo, she spent her childhood in Japan, New Hampshire and Southern California. She has spent the last five years in the scenic Columbia Gorge region of Oregon, where she drew much of her inspiration from Mt Hood (Wy’East) and the Columbia River. She now finds herself in New York’s Hudson Valley, an area with its own wealth of stunning scenery to inspire her next piece.
Primarily working with acrylic paint on canvas, Alexandria creates colorful landscapes of the picturesque views she has experienced. While her earlier work focused more on nude figurative pieces, the shift to landscapes came after being exposed to the breathtaking views that Oregon had to offer. She captures the feeling of a place by bringing together vibrant colors and shapes, creating a unique style that offers a fresh take on familiar scenery.
